Lawrenceburg vs Lexington-Fayette urban county, Kentucky

Side-by-side comparison

How does Lawrenceburg, KY compare to Lexington-Fayette urban county, Kentucky, KY? Lawrenceburg has a population of 11,838 with a median household income of $63,690, while Lexington-Fayette urban county, Kentucky has 321,122 residents and a median income of $67,631.
